Advanced Spatial Analysis Skills for Urban Planning in the UK: Job Market Insights
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Urban Planner (GIS Specialist) | Develops and implements spatial planning strategies using advanced GIS software and spatial analysis techniques. High demand for expertise in urban modeling and demographic analysis. |
| Geographic Information Systems (GIS) Analyst | Analyzes geospatial data to support decision-making in urban planning projects. Requires proficiency in data manipulation, spatial statistics, and cartography. Strong spatial analysis skills are essential. |
| Transportation Planner (Spatial Modeling) | Develops and evaluates transportation plans using spatial modeling techniques. Requires expertise in network analysis, traffic simulation, and accessibility modeling. Strong skills in spatial analysis are key. |
| Urban Data Scientist | Applies statistical modeling and machine learning to large urban datasets to forecast future trends and inform policy decisions. Requires advanced skills in spatial statistics and data visualization. |
